US Ladies in town!

The US Ladies 2016 Tour arrived in Edinburgh today with lunch before before piped onto the ice at 2.30pm. Twenty US ladies played against the Scottish ladies and let's just say the tourists did very well.  This was followed by coffee and cake before heading off with their hosts for the evening.  Tomorrow will see them have a free day in Edinburgh. Nail biting start to the Swan Trophy!

The first round of the Swan Trophy, now kindly sponsored by Graham's The Family Dairy, saw a draw shot decider between Mid Calder and Oxenfoord!  The Mid Calder rink skipped by Basil Baird beat Oxenfoord rink skipped by Trevor Dodds 5-3.
